Controlling the Orientation and Synaptic Differentiation of Myotubes with Micropatterned Substrates
Micropatterned poly(dimethylsiloxane) substrates fabricated by soft lithography led to large-scale orientation of myoblasts in culture, thereby controlling the orientation of the myotubes they formed.
